Social Services and Outreach

Food For Sharing
Parishioners are invited to bring non-perishable food
items and paper products to Mass on the weekend. The items
are collected and counted and taken to the Open Door
Outreach Center in Union Lake. The Open Door is the local
agency for food and clothing distribution. Other food
collections happen once a month at a school mass,
Thanksgiving eve, and Thanksgiving Day, and on the feast
day of St. Vincent de Paul.
We also participate in Operation Rice Bowl during the
season of Lent. This almsgiving program helps support
the work of Catholic Relief Services.

Seasonal Sharing
This occurs at Christmas, Easter and the beginning of
school in August. Tags are hung and parishioners are
invited to take a tag, purchase the requested item,
and return it by the distribution date. Gifts and gift
certificates are sorted and delivered to local agencies,
who then make them available to their clients. Other
recipients of the Sharing Program include homebound
parishioners and the residents of local nursing care
facilities and adult care homes.


Mission Support through Coffee and Donuts
Coffee and donuts are served almost every Sunday
morning in the parish social hall following the 8 am. and
10 am. Masses. Families, groups and individuals help
set up, serve and clean up. This gathering provides
fellowship for parishioners as well as money for the
6 missions we support.

Parish Tithing Program
St. Patrick parish tithes 3 percent of the weekend
collections for outreach. A committtee of parishioners
meets monthly to determine the amount and the recipient
of the grant. Grant requests must be made in writing.
The agency or organization applying for a grant must be
in union with the values of the Gospel of Life and
Catholic Social Teaching in order to be considered
for a grant.
